负载均衡是现代网络架构中至关重要的组成部分,它通过将流量分配到多个服务器上,提高了系统的处理能力、可靠性和可扩展性,负载均衡器的放置位置直接影响其性能和效果,因此了解不同部署方式及其适用场景非常重要。
一、负载均衡的基本概念

负载均衡是一种计算机网络技术,用于在多个计算资源(如服务器、CPU、磁盘驱动器等)之间分配工作负载,其目的是优化资源使用、最大化吞吐量、最小化响应时间,并避免单个资源的过载。
二、负载均衡的分类
根据不同的标准,负载均衡可以分为多种类型:
1、按实现方式分类:
硬件负载均衡:通过专用设备实现,性能高但成本昂贵。
软件负载均衡:通过在现有服务器上安装软件实现,成本低但可能消耗系统资源。
2、按应用层次分类:
四层负载均衡:基于IP地址和端口号进行流量转发,适用于TCP/UDP协议。

七层负载均衡:基于应用层协议(如HTTP、HTTPS)进行流量转发,可以处理更复杂的请求。
3、按地理位置分类:
本地负载均衡:针对本地范围内的服务器群进行负载均衡。
全局负载均衡:针对不同地理位置的服务器群进行负载均衡,适用于跨国公司或全球服务。
三、负载均衡的部署方式
负载均衡器可以放置在网络架构的不同位置,每种部署方式都有其优缺点和适用场景。
1、路由模式:
部署方式:负载均衡器作为路由器,所有返回的流量都经过负载均衡器。

优点:对网络改动小,能均衡任何下行流量。
缺点:配置相对复杂,需要调整服务器网关设置。
适用场景:适合大多数企业网络环境,尤其是需要灵活部署的场景。
2、桥接模式:
部署方式:负载均衡器作为桥接设备,不改变现有网络架构。
优点:配置简单,不需要更改现有网络结构。
缺点:容错性差,对广播风暴敏感。
适用场景:适用于网络架构较为简单且不需要高容错性的环境。
3、服务直接返回模式(DSR):
部署方式:负载均衡器直接将流量分发到后端服务器,服务器直接响应客户端请求。
优点:适用于大流量高带宽要求的服务。
缺点:返回流量不经过负载均衡器,无法进行后续处理。
适用场景分发网络(CDN)等需要高吞吐量的应用。
四、负载均衡算法
负载均衡算法决定了如何将请求分配给后端服务器,常见的算法包括:
1、轮询法:按顺序将请求分配给每个服务器。
2、随机法:随机选择一台服务器来分配请求。
3、最小连接法:将请求分配给当前连接数最少的服务器。
4、加权轮询法:根据服务器的性能权重分配请求。
五、负载均衡的实际应用
在实际应用中,负载均衡器通常部署在以下几个位置:
1、数据中心入口:作为数据中心的总入口,负责将外部流量分配到内部的各个服务器或服务集群。
2、服务集群前端:在Web服务器集群、数据库集群或应用服务器集群前部署负载均衡器,确保流量均匀分配。
3、云服务提供商网络:在云计算环境中,负载均衡器通常由云服务提供商提供,用户可以通过API或控制台进行配置和管理。
六、负载均衡的优势
负载均衡不仅提高了系统的性能和可靠性,还带来了以下优势:
1、提高资源利用率:通过合理分配请求,避免单个服务器过载。
2、增强系统可用性:通过冗余机制,即使部分服务器故障,也能保证服务的连续性。
3、提升用户体验:减少响应时间,提高访问速度。
4、支持弹性扩展:根据实际负载动态添加或移除服务器。
七、负载均衡的常见问题解答
1、什么是负载均衡?
答:负载均衡是一种计算机网络技术,用于在多个计算资源之间分配工作负载,以优化资源使用、最大化吞吐量、最小化响应时间,并避免单个资源的过载。
2、负载均衡器应该放在哪里?
答:负载均衡器的放置位置取决于具体的应用场景和需求,可以放置在数据中心入口、服务集群前端或云服务提供商网络中,选择合适的位置可以最大化负载均衡的效果和性能。
负载均衡是提高系统性能和可靠性的重要手段,其部署位置应根据具体需求和网络架构来决定,通过合理选择负载均衡器的类型和部署方式,可以有效提升系统的整体表现。
以上内容就是解答有关“负载均衡一般放哪个位置”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复